How hard is Ride the Lightning on guitar?

It’s actually not a hard solo but it is challenging if you’re new to lead guitar. I recommend breaking up the solo into a dozen of more sections and practice each section separately before trying to put it all together. You also have to pay attention to note groupings (triplets, 16th notes, etc.)

Are tabs good for beginners?

Tablature, or tabs, is a form of musical notation meant for fretted instruments like the guitar. Beginners can use easy acoustic guitar tabs to learn songs without needing to know how to read standard musical notation.

Is it better to learn chords or tabs?

Chords Are More Important than Tabs The melodies of the song dance around the chords–going up and down and around the fundamental notes of that chord. If you start to get a better feel for chords, you’ll find that guitar tabs often are just derivatives of the chords themselves.

How many BPM is Master of Puppets?

The guitar work of Metallica’s “Master of Puppets” is almost entirely played using downstroked eighth-notes at a tempo of 212 BPM (about 7 downstrokes per second). Up-tempo down-stroke picking requires a strong wrist to keep muscle movements as tension-free as possible.
